Cabinet Action — Cahier d'exercices

Exercices : three en anglais

20 exercices progressifs pour maitriser "three", "third", "thirteen" et "thirty".

Exercice 1 — Ecrire en lettres

  1. 3 → ______________
  2. 13 → ______________
  3. 30 → ______________
  4. 33 → ______________
  5. 300 → ______________
Solutions : three / thirteen / thirty / thirty-three / three hundred

Exercice 2 — Cardinal ou ordinal ?

  1. I live on the ______ (3) floor.
  2. She has ______ (3) cats.
  3. It's my ______ (3) coffee today.
  4. We need ______ (3) volunteers.
  5. Today is the ______ (3) of June.
Solutions : third / three / third / three / third

Exercice 3 — Prononciation (vrai/faux)

  1. "three" se prononce /friː/ — V / F
  2. "third" se prononce /θɜːrd/ — V / F
  3. "thirty" est accentue sur la 2e syllabe — V / F
  4. "thirteen" rime avec "fifteen" — V / F
  5. Le TH de three est sonore — V / F
Solutions : F (/θriː/) / V / F (1re syllabe) / V / F (sourd)

Exercice 4 — Traduisez en anglais

  1. J'ai trois reunions cet apres-midi.
  2. Le train part a trois heures.
  3. C'est ma troisieme tentative.
  4. Un tiers des employes sont absents.
  5. Il a trente-trois ans.
Solutions :
1. I have three meetings this afternoon.
2. The train leaves at three o'clock.
3. It's my third attempt.
4. A third of employees are absent.
5. He is thirty-three years old.
